Description
Portsmouth, Va. (Feb. 13, 2004) – The nuclear powered aircraft carrier USS Harry S. Truman (CVN-75) transits the Elizabeth River following completion of a six-month Planned Incremental Availability (PIA) at Norfolk Naval Shipyard. Truman completed her yard period a week ahead of schedule and 4 million dollars under budget.
